Myth #4: Quality Control is Impossible When Buying Online
The Reality: While you can’t physically inspect the scrap before buying, there are several ways to ensure quality control when buying online.
Busting the Myth:
- Request Samples: Ask the seller to provide samples of the scrap material for inspection. This allows you to assess the quality and suitability of the material before committing to a larger purchase.
- Demand Certifications: Request certifications and documentation that verify the quality and origin of the scrap material. This can include certificates of analysis, inspection reports, and customs documents.
- Third-Party Inspection: Hire a third-party inspection agency to inspect the scrap material on your behalf. This provides an independent assessment of the quality and quantity of the material.
- Detailed Contracts: Clearly define the quality specifications in your purchase contract. This provides legal recourse if the scrap material does not meet the agreed-upon standards.
By implementing these quality control measures, you can confidently buy scrap online knowing that you’re getting the quality you expect.
Myth #5: It’s Too Difficult to Handle Logistics and Shipping
The Reality: Arranging logistics and shipping can seem overwhelming, especially if you’re new to buying scrap online. However, many online platforms offer support and resources to help you manage these aspects of the transaction.
Busting the Myth:
- Platform Logistics Support: Scrap Trade offers logistics support to help you arrange shipping and transportation of your scrap purchases. We can connect you with reputable logistics providers and help you navigate the complexities of international shipping.
- Incoterms: Familiarize yourself with Incoterms (International Commercial Terms), which define the responsibilities of the buyer and seller in international trade transactions. This helps you understand who is responsible for shipping, insurance, and customs clearance.
- Freight Forwarders: Work with experienced freight forwarders who specialize in scrap metal shipments. They can handle all aspects of the logistics process, including customs clearance, documentation, and transportation.
- Insurance: Ensure that your scrap shipments are adequately insured to protect against loss or damage during transit.
With proper planning and the support of a reliable platform and logistics partners, you can easily manage the logistics of buying scrap online.
